Transaction 14403030cea708fde96ec25fbe18f93bd797e10c995b2244777b6ff2ad3a3a09

1 Input
2 Outputs
  • 14403030cea708fde96ec25fbe18f93bd797e10c995b2244777b6ff2ad3a3a09:0
  • value  289960
    address  3QfeMCi9szX8XpVike8G5okrNiiiT9Vig6
  • 14403030cea708fde96ec25fbe18f93bd797e10c995b2244777b6ff2ad3a3a09:1
  • value  18163191
    address  3HxnbkD5z3hQ5QpK5uNKaPdc7VbZ6AZ7qW